Using the increase of dual-income households and non-traditional work hours, the need for 24-hour daycare solutions happens to be steadily increasing. 24-hour daycare facilities provide moms and dads the flexibleness they must stabilize work and family members duties, and provide a safe and nurturing environment for children around-the-clock.

Benefits of 24-Hour Daycare:

One of many key great things about 24-hour daycare could be the mobility it offers working parents. Many moms and dads work changes that increase beyond standard daycare hours, rendering it difficult to find childcare that meets their schedule. 24-hour daycare facilities resolve this problem by providing treatment during nights, vacations, plus overnight. This enables parents to your workplace without fretting about finding someone to view kids during non-traditional hours.

Another advantageous asset of 24-hour daycare may be the satisfaction it provides to parents. Understanding that kids are increasingly being cared for by trained experts in a safe and safe environment can alleviate the tension and guilt that often includes making young ones in daycare. Moms and dads can give attention to their particular work comprehending that kids come in good hands, that may cause increased output and work satisfaction.

Additionally, 24-hour daycare centers provides a sense of community and assistance for households. Moms and dads just who work non-traditional hours frequently find it difficult to find childcare options that meet their needs, causing emotions of isolation and tension. 24-hour daycare centers could possibly offer a sense of that belong and camaraderie among parents dealing with similar challenges, producing a support network which will help households thrive.

Difficulties of 24-Hour Daycare:

While 24-hour daycare centers provide benefits, they even incorporate their particular set of difficulties. One of the greatest challenges is staffing. Finding qualified and trustworthy childcare providers who are ready to work non-traditional hours could be hard, causing large turnover rates and prospective staffing shortages. This could easily impact the grade of treatment supplied to children and produce instability for households relying on 24-hour daycare services.

Another challenge of 24-hour daycare could be the expense. Supplying care around-the-clock needs additional staffing and sources, which can drive up the cost of solutions. This is a barrier for low-income households who is almost certainly not in a position to manage 24-hour daycare, making all of them with restricted choices for childcare during non-traditional hours.

Regulation and Oversight:

In order to make sure the security and well being of young ones in 24-hour daycare facilities, legislation and supervision are crucial. State and neighborhood governments set requirements for licensing and certification of daycare centers, including the ones that work around the clock. These criteria cover an array of places, including staff-to-child ratios, safe practices requirements, and staff training and qualifications.

As well as federal government laws, numerous 24-hour daycare centers decide to seek certification from national organizations like the nationwide Association for the knowledge of Young Children (NAEYC) and/or National Association for Family Child Care (NAFCC). Accreditation demonstrates dedication to top-quality attention and certainly will assist parents feel confident in their range of childcare provider.
